Expression of neutrophil elastase and myeloperoxidase mRNA in patients with newly diagnosed type 2 diabetes mellitus.

Abstract

BACKGROUND AND AIMS

Neutrophil elastase and myeloperoxidase enzymes protect us from infection by killing pathogens. However, exaggerated activities of these enzymes can induce tissue damage, inflammation and oxidative stress. The present study was aimed to explore the expressions of neutrophil elastase and myeloperoxidase mRNA in the peripheral blood leukocytes (PBL) in patients with newly diagnosed type 2 diabetes mellitus.

METHODS

In this cross-sectional study, 104 participants including 65 normoglycemic control subjects and 39 newly diagnosed type 2 diabetes patients were recruited. Glycemic and metabolic markers were evaluated from fasting blood samples. The mRNA levels of neutrophil elastase and myeloperoxidase genes in the PBL were quantified by real-time quantitative PCR.

RESULTS

Compared to control subjects, diabetes patients showed a significant down regulation of both neutrophil elastase (p = 0.039) and myeloperoxidase (p = 0.023) mRNA expressions in the PBL. The neutrophil elastase and myeloperoxidase mRNA levels showed a negative trend with fasting glucose levels but did not show any significant correlations with HbA1c, insulin level, insulin resistance or sensitivity status.

CONCLUSIONS

It was concluded that type 2 diabetes mellitus is associated with a decrease in neutrophil elastase and myeloperoxidase gene expression in the PBL.

摘要

背景与目的

中性粒细胞弹性蛋白酶和髓过氧化物酶可通过杀灭病原体来保护我们免受感染。然而,这些酶的过度活性会导致组织损伤、炎症和氧化应激。本研究旨在探讨新诊断的2型糖尿病患者外周血白细胞(PBL)中中性粒细胞弹性蛋白酶和髓过氧化物酶mRNA的表达情况。

方法

在这项横断面研究中,招募了104名参与者,包括65名血糖正常的对照者和39名新诊断的2型糖尿病患者。从空腹血样中评估血糖和代谢指标。通过实时定量PCR定量PBL中中性粒细胞弹性蛋白酶和髓过氧化物酶基因的mRNA水平。

结果

与对照者相比,糖尿病患者PBL中中性粒细胞弹性蛋白酶(p = 0.039)和髓过氧化物酶(p = 0.023)的mRNA表达均显著下调。中性粒细胞弹性蛋白酶和髓过氧化物酶的mRNA水平与空腹血糖水平呈负相关趋势,但与糖化血红蛋白、胰岛素水平、胰岛素抵抗或敏感性状态无显著相关性。

结论

得出结论,2型糖尿病与PBL中中性粒细胞弹性蛋白酶和髓过氧化物酶基因表达降低有关。
